Cayzor Athabasca Mines
Showing Name : Cayzor Uranium Mine (“17” ore shoot)
Mineral Resource Assessment: Past Producing Mine with Uranium Reserves.
Deposit classification: Shear Hosted Vein Type Basement Rock Associated U-Pb.
Deposit Status: Past Producer
Host Rock: Metasediment
Geological Domain: Beaverlodge
Between May 1957 and March 1960 the
Cayzor Mine produced
187 tons of Uranium. The Eldorado
Mill was closed due to the collapse
of the Uranium Market.
The company
purchased a group of 16 claims from Azor Mines
Limited and from 1953-54 an extensive diamond
drill program was carried out to evaluate the
previously-discovered showing. In November 1954
shaft sinking commenced and a shaft was
eventually sunk in excess of 900 feet with
levels established at 170, 320, 445, 570, and
675 feet. No lateral work was done on the sixth
level at 900 feet.

Don Lake. SMDI #1393 Claim #107439
Showing Name: Don Lake Uranium Deposit or Don A, B, and C zones.
Deposit Classification: Shear Hosted Disseminated Basement Rock Associated Uranium
Deposit Status: Deposit - Reserves
Host Rock: Metamorphic
Geological Domain: Zemlak (Black Bay)
Zone A has intersected uranium mineralization along one main vein with a
known length of 700 ft (213.4 m) and that crosses the trend of a northeast striking lineament. Seven trenches and 19 drill holes have been completed over the zone and it is estimated that the zone contains possible reserves of 30,701 lbs of U308.
Zone B is considered to be a continuation of the A Zone.
Zone C occurs along a band of northwest-striking basic rocks. Assays from trenches and drill holes returned from 0.03% to 3.02% U3O8/ton (0.025% to 2.56% U/ton).
Nineteen of these holes contained radioactive significant values over mineable widths were intersected. The highest assay abtained was 10.7% U308 (9.08% U) from a 1 ft intersection in hole No.23. This hole is about 300 ft away from hole No.1, drilled by Eldorado in 1950, from which a 2 ft section averaging 2% U308 (1.7% U) is believed to have been obtained.
Consolidated Beta-Gamma Mines. SMDI #1394 Claim #107925
Showing Name: Beta Gamma Uranium Mine {Zones 1 and 2}
Mineral Resource Assessment: Past Producing Mine Without Reserves U (See reserves)
Deposit Classification: Shear Hosted Disseminated Basement Rock Associated Uranium
Deposit Status: Past Producer
Host Rock: Metasediment
Geological Domain: Zemlak (Black Bay)
In 1952, Beta Gamma Mines Ltd. (renamed Consolidated Beta Gamma Mines Ltd. in 1952) acquired the claims. They did prospecting on the claims and revealed 8 radioactive zones. The No.1 Zone on the Heron Shear was tested to a vertical depth of 60 ft (18.3 m) by drill holes spaced 100 ft (30.5 m) apart. At the same, time two holes were drilled into the No. 2 Zone.
In 1953, further drilling was carried out and the results indicated further work was warranted. A 3-compartment shaft was collared between the Zones No. 1 and No. 2. Underground exploration was halted in March 1954 after the shaft had been sunk to 154 ft (46.9m) with 596 ft (181.7m) of lateral development work on the 134 ft (40.8m) level.
Leonard Uranium Mine. Rix Athabasca #10 Adit
Showing Name: Leonard Uranium Mine, Rix Athabasca No. 10 Adit
Mineral Resource Assessment: Past Producing Mine Without Reserves U
Deposit Classification: Shear Hosted Vein Type Basement Rock Associated U-Cu-Pb
Deposit Status: Past Producer
Host Rock: Metavolcanic, Plutonic
Geological Domain: Beaverlodge
The mine produce 77 tons (154,000 Ibs) of uranium between 1957 and 1960. The Leonard deposit was first explored underground in 1951 by a 3814oot adit driven along the largest vein but this work was suspended when attention shifted to the Smitty deposi in the following year. Renewed interest was shown in the 1955 and the ore shoot was mined above the adit level. Early in 1956 the adit was widened and an internal shaft was sunk with lateral development on the 125-th floor and 250-th foot levels. In 1959 the shaft was deepened to 360 feet and two more levels were opened up. Shipments of ore to the Eldorado mill commenced in March 1958 and continued until 1960 when the ore zone became depleted. It is believed that about 50,000 tons of ore grading 0.2 per cent and better were removed from the deposit.
St. Michael Uranium Mine. SMDI #1409
Showing Name: St. Michael Uranium Mine
Mineral Resource Assessment: Past Producing Mine With Reserves U
Deposit Classification: Shear Hosted Vein Type Basement Rock Associated Uranium
Deposit Status: Past Producer
Host Rock: Metavolcanic
Geological Domain: Beaverlodge
By 1957, 600,000 lbs of U308 were mined. Between 1968 and 1960, a further 70,000 tons of ore were shipped. Between 1952 and 1953, the showing area was covered by Lodge Bay Uranium Mines RAZ 5 fraction. Lodge Bay mapped the property (AF 74N10- 0155). In December 1954, St. Michael Uranium Mines Ltd. acquired ownership of a small group of 7 RAZ claims on which previous work by Lodge Uranium Mines had outlined four radioactive zones. Prospecting by trenching and surface diamond drilling done by St. Michael Mines during the period 1954 to 1955 obtained several encouraging results.
Smitty Mine (Rix #27)
Poduced 436 tons (872,000 Ibs) of Uranium
Showing Name: Smitty Uranium Mine or Smitty U Showing or Rix U Showing No. 27, Boom Lake Showing Adit or ‘62 Zone’, West U Zone (extension of the 62 Zone)
Mineral Resource Assessment: Past Producing Mine Without Reserves U (See AF 7410-0333)
Deposit Classification: Shear Hosted Disseminated Basement Rock Associated
Deposit Status: Past Producer
Host Rock: Metasediment
Geological Domain: Zemlak (Black Bay)
A shaft was sunk late in 1952 and two levels were established on the 125 foot (38.1 m) and 250 foot (76.2 m) levels. In 1953, sufficient ore had been outlined to warrant production. A contract to ship ore to the Eldorado Mill was negotiated, and when Rix began shipment of ore at the rate of 100 tons a day in April 1954, the mine became the first privately owned Canadian uranium producer.
New Hosco Mines Limited
Ford Lake
The Fold Lake area is underlain by a comformable sequence of quartzite, amphibolite, and garneriferouse gneisses. The sequence is strongly folded into broad open folds with steeply dipping limbs; the most prominent fold is a northeast-plunging syncline; the nose of which occurs just south of Fold Lake.
Fold Lake claim consists of at least five showings, three of which #86, #85 which are considered “with high grade potential or warranting further work. Seven channel samples cut across the vein gave an average grade of 0.49% and 0.9% for a length of 40 feet.

Gussie Mineral Claim Group
The Gussie group is located in the highly mineralized northeast-southwest trending belt containing the Boom Lake and Leonard faults, and along which are situated, within a few miles to the southwest the Cayzor, St. Michaels, Rix Smitty, and Rix Leonard former uranium producers. To the northeast lies the Don Lake group of mineral claims formerly held by Eldorado and now by Matrix, on which considerable exploration work was carried out this season. Several interesting mineralized zones have been established on the Don Lake property and 3,937 feet of exploratory drilling has been carried out on three zones.
